webbrowser + u-s-s-online-accounts + ubuntu-html5-theme fail to build against Qt 5.4
| Affects | Status | Importance | Assigned to | Milestone | |
|---|---|---|---|---|---|
| | ubuntu-html5-theme (Ubuntu) |
Undecided
|
Unassigned | ||
| | ubuntu-system-settings-online-accounts (Ubuntu) |
Undecided
|
Timo Jyrinki | ||
| | webbrowser-app (Ubuntu) |
Undecided
|
Olivier Tilloy | ||
Bug Description
Similar to bug #1398044 (oxide) and bug #1397979 (ui-toolkit), webbrowser-app and ubuntu-
This bug will become invalid if bug #1387537 is fixed instead.
Build logs:
https:/
https:/
More information about Qt testing at https:/
Related branches
- PS Jenkins bot: Needs Fixing (continuous-integration) on 2014-12-03
- Ubuntu Phablet Team: Pending requested 2014-12-03
-
Diff: 15 lines (+3/-1)1 file modifiedsrc/app/browserapplication.cpp (+3/-1)
- PS Jenkins bot: Approve (continuous-integration) on 2015-02-09
- Online Accounts: Pending requested 2015-02-09
-
Diff: 19 lines (+5/-3)1 file modifiedonline-accounts-ui/main.cpp (+5/-3)
| description: | updated |
| description: | updated |
| Changed in webbrowser-app (Ubuntu): | |
| assignee: | nobody → Olivier Tilloy (osomon) |
| Changed in webbrowser-app (Ubuntu): | |
| status: | New → Confirmed |
| Changed in webbrowser-app (Ubuntu): | |
| status: | Confirmed → In Progress |
| Launchpad Janitor (janitor) wrote : | #1 |
| Changed in webbrowser-app (Ubuntu): | |
| status: | In Progress → Fix Released |
| Timo Jyrinki (timo-jyrinki) wrote : | #2 |
Marking the ubuntu-html5-theme here as well, which started using the same private header and has the #if clause included. Bug #1387537 is about getting rid of the private headers, this one about patching the codes as long as 1387537 isn't resolved.
| summary: |
- webbrowser + u-s-s-online-accounts fail to build against Qt 5.4 + webbrowser + u-s-s-online-accounts + ubuntu-html5-theme fail to build + against Qt 5.4 |
| Changed in ubuntu-html5-theme (Ubuntu): | |
| status: | New → Fix Released |
| Dmitry Shachnev (mitya57) wrote : | #3 |
ubuntu-html5-theme built fine now:
https:/
| Dmitry Shachnev (mitya57) wrote : | #4 |
And u-s-s-online-
https:/
| Changed in ubuntu-system-settings-online-accounts (Ubuntu): | |
| status: | New → Fix Committed |
| Dmitry Shachnev (mitya57) wrote : | #5 |
Re-opening u-s-s-online-
https:/
| Changed in ubuntu-system-settings-online-accounts (Ubuntu): | |
| status: | Fix Committed → Triaged |
| Timo Jyrinki (timo-jyrinki) wrote : | #6 |
Bug #1403420 covers the tests part, this bug was originally about the private headers usage.
| Changed in ubuntu-system-settings-online-accounts (Ubuntu): | |
| status: | Triaged → Fix Committed |
| Albert Astals Cid (aacid) wrote : | #7 |
The tests are being tracked at https:/
| Changed in ubuntu-system-settings-online-accounts (Ubuntu): | |
| status: | Fix Committed → Fix Released |
| Timo Jyrinki (timo-jyrinki) wrote : | #8 |
Oh, but, the fix for u-s-s-o-a indeed has not been done yet... only workarounds in the PPA.
| Changed in ubuntu-system-settings-online-accounts (Ubuntu): | |
| status: | Fix Released → Triaged |
| assignee: | nobody → Timo Jyrinki (timo-jyrinki) |
| status: | Triaged → In Progress |
| Launchpad Janitor (janitor) wrote : | #9 |
This bug was fixed in the package ubuntu-
---------------
ubuntu-
[ CI Train Bot ]
* Fix tests with Qt 5.4
[ Timo Jyrinki ]
* Use qt_gl_set_
#1398372)
-- Ubuntu daily release <email address hidden> Wed, 11 Feb 2015 06:39:10 +0000
| Changed in ubuntu-system-settings-online-accounts (Ubuntu): | |
| status: | In Progress → Fix Released |


This bug was fixed in the package webbrowser-app - 0.23+15. 04.20141211. 4-0ubuntu1
--------------- 04.20141211. 4-0ubuntu1) vivid; urgency=low
webbrowser-app (0.23+15.
[ Ubuntu daily release ]
* New rebuild forced
[ Olivier Tilloy ]
* Take captures of live webviews and cache them on disk, to use them
as tab previews. (LP: #1359293, #1401045)
* Fix FTBFS on Qt 5.4. (LP: #1398372)
* Reset the webview’s certificate error when the user cancels it (by
e.g. committing a new navigation). (LP: #1398905, #1394925)
-- Ubuntu daily release <email address hidden> Thu, 11 Dec 2014 18:54:12 +0000